Liverpool Football Club Museum Entry





Description
Discover and experience the LFC story from past to the present. State-of-the-art exhibits showcase iconic moments, legendary players and illustrious achievements. From humble origins to one of the world’s most historic and famous football clubs, the reimagined space is a celebration of LFC’s status as English football’s most successful club. Featuring nine new spaces, the museum takes you on a journey through time. Travel through the different spaces with interactive displays to bring the club’s story to life, including a closer look at the evolution of the famous LFC kits, and for the first time all the major trophies have been brought together in one place. Important Information
- Wheelchair accessible
- Infants and small children can ride in a pram or stroller
- Service animals allowed
- Public transportation options are available nearby
- All areas and surfaces are wheelchair accessible
- Suitable for all physical fitness levels
- Last entrance into the museum on non-match days is 4:00 PM
- Last entrance into the museum on match days is 1 hour before kick-off. Kick off times vary.
- All bags are subject to security checks. Large items or luggage are not permitted.
- Food and drink cannot be taken into the museum.
- Children must be accompanied by an adult.
- Parking is available in Stanley Park Car Park - Charges may apply (Non Match days Only)
